What can I see and do near Teatro Verdi?
You'll want to browse the collections at Ceramics Museum, Museo Roberto Papi, and Virtual Museum of Salerno's Medical School. Salerno Cathedral, Palazzo di Citta di Salerno, and Castello di Arechi are some of the notable landmarks to see in the area. Spend some time wandering around Minerva Garden, Lungomare Trieste, and Villa Comunale di Salerno.
